Pipeline / Facilities Project Manager - (Semi-Remote)
LONGHORN STAFFING SOLUTIONS is seeking a Pipeline / Facilities Project Manager to oversee construction projects. The role involves planning, organizing, and directing project execution to meet cost, quality, and safety objectives while managing staff and coordinating with various stakeholders.
Responsibilities
Assume overall responsibility for a profitable, well-constructed, safe project, completed in a timely manner
Review project proposal and pertinent documents with project team and Business Unit Director
Determine the most cost-effective construction methods and use of personnel, material, equipment and subcontractors
Review and approve subcontractor selections and invoicing
Coordinate construction activities with the customer, subcontractors and company personnel
Promote, enforce and establish safety as a priority as part of the Company’s management philosophy
Manage project staff, including assigned support staff, superintendents, project general foreman, and assistants
Ensure that management is accurately and fully informed of project costs as compared to budgets through weekly labor and monthly budget reports
Coordinate and provide direction for the budget estimating, purchasing, engineering, accounting, cost, and construction functions as they relate to the completion of the project
Initiate, establish and maintain working relationships with owners, engineers, suppliers, and subcontractors to facilitate construction activities
Organize, conduct and represent the company at project coordination meetings at regular agreed upon intervals
Review and approve subcontractor, vendor payment applications and miscellaneous invoices
Negotiate, prepare, issue and execute change orders (proposals) to owners, design team, subcontractors and others, and prepare revisions to the original budget because of changes and revisions to work
Ensure timely and accurate billings and accounts receivable
Ensure timely project completion through project scheduling, expediting of material deliveries and the management of material and document submittals/approvals
Lead and participate in regularly schedule project staff meetings
Manage Closeout process
Enforce and adhere to all Policies and Processes as it relates to this position
